Web20 de abr. de 2024 · The Constitution provides that a judge can be removed only by an order of the President, based on a motion passed by both Houses of Parliament. The procedure for removal of judges is elaborated in the Judges Inquiry Act, 1968. Web19 de abr. de 2015 · The procedure for removing judges and magistrates in NSW is based upon the federal model. Accordingly, no holder of a judicial office can be removed except by the Governor on address from both houses of the NSW Parliament in the one session.
